申请SSL证书

SSL证书在线一键申请,低至18元/月,98元/年,单域名、多域名、通配符,申请SSL就上一门SSL平台!

ssl免费证书申请地址

SSL(Secure Sockets Layer)是一种用于保护数据传输的加密技术,它可以在客户端和服务器之间建立一条安全的通信路径,以确保数据传输的安全性和完整性。SSL证书则是用于验证服务器身份的电子证书,在建立SSL连接时,客户端会收到服务器发送的SSL证书,以确认服务器的身份是否合法,从而保证通信的安全性。

在过去,SSL证书的申请和安装需要支付较高的费用,而现在已经出现了一些免费的SSL证书申请服务,其中最知名的是Let's Encrypt。

Let's Encrypt是一个非营利性组织,旨在推广和普及HTTPS协议,提供免费的SSL证书申请服务。以下是Let's Encrypt SSL免费证书申请的详细介绍:

1. 准备工作

在申请SSL证书之前,需要确保服务器满足以下条件:

- 公网IP地址(可以通过ping命令或者访问http://ip.cn/等网站获取)

- 域名(可以通过域名注册商购买或者使用免费的二级域名服务)

- 80端口和443端口开放(用于验证域名和安装SSL证书)

2. 安装Certbot

Certbot是Let's Encrypt官方提供的免费SSL证书申请工具,可以自动化地申请、验证和安装SSL证书。在Linux系统中,可以通过以下命令安装Certbot:

```

$ sudo apt-get update

$ sudo apt-get install certbot

```

3. 申请SSL证书

在安装Certbot之后,就可以开始申请SSL证书了。在Linux系统中,可以通过以下命令申请SSL证书:

```

$ sudo certbot certonly --standalone -d example.com -d www.example.com

```

其中,example.com是你的域名,www.example.com是你的域名的www子域名。这个命令会使用Certbot的standalone插件,在80端口上启动一个临时的HTTP服务器,用于验证域名的所有权。在验证通过后,Certbot会自动下载并安装SSL证书。

4. 配置Web服务器

在安装完SSL证书之后,需要将Web服务器的配置文件进行相应的修改,以启用HTTPS协议。在Nginx服务器中,可以在配置文件中添加以下内容:

```

server {

listen 443 ssl;

server_name example.com;

ssl_certificate /etc/letsencrypt/live/example.com/fullchain.pem;

ssl_certificate_key /etc/letsencrypt/live/example.com/privkey.pem;

...

}

```

其中,example.com是你的域名,/etc/letsencrypt/live/example.com/fullchain.pem是SSL证书的公钥文件路径,/etc/letsencrypt/live/example.com/privkey.pem是SSL证书的私钥文件路径。

5. 自动更新SSL证书

Let's Encrypt免费SSL证书的有效期只有90天,因此需要定期更新SSL证书。可以通过设置定时任务,自动更新SSL证书。在Linux系统中,可以通过以下命令设置定时任务:

```

$ sudo crontab -e

```

然后在打开的编辑器中添加以下内容:

```

0 0 1 * * /usr/bin/certbot renew --quiet

```

这个命令表示每个月的1号0点0分,自动更新SSL证书。如果SSL证书即将过期,Certbot会自动更新证书,否则不会进行任何操作。

以上就是Let's Encrypt SSL免费证书申请的详细介绍。通过Let's Encrypt免费SSL证书,可以为网站提供更加安全的传输保障,提高用户的信任度和满意度。


相关知识:
申请ssl证书时验证出错
SSL证书是保证网站安全的重要组成部分,它能够确保网站的数据传输是加密的,防止黑客窃取用户的个人信息或者篡改网站内容。但是,在申请SSL证书的过程中,经常会出现验证失败的情况,这时候需要对出错的原因进行分析,才能够及时解决问题。SSL证书的验证主要分为两个
2023-04-06
ssl证书申请难不难
SSL证书是一种加密技术,用于保护网站上传输的数据的安全。它通过在浏览器和服务器之间建立一个安全的通道来确保数据的加密和完整性。在网站上使用SSL证书可以提高网站的安全性,保护用户的隐私信息,提高用户信任度和购物体验。SSL证书的申请过程相对来说不太难,但
2023-04-06
并申请全球通用ssl证书
SSL证书,全称为Secure Sockets Layer证书,是一种数字证书,用于确保网站和用户之间的安全通信。SSL证书使用加密技术,可以保护网站和用户之间的数据传输,防止敏感数据被窃取或篡改。在今天的互联网环境中,SSL证书已成为网站安全的基础,越来
2023-04-06
域名ssl证书申请流程
SSL证书是一种用于保护网站数据安全的加密技术。它通过对网站进行数字证书认证,确保用户与网站之间的通信是加密和安全的。在这篇文章中,我们将详细介绍域名SSL证书的申请流程。第一步:选择SSL证书类型在申请SSL证书之前,您需要先选择适合您网站的SSL证书类
2023-04-06
sslcertificate申请
SSL证书是一种用于保证网站安全性的数字证书,通过对数据进行加密和解密,确保数据传输的安全和可靠性。SSL证书的申请过程包含以下几个步骤:1. 选择SSL证书类型根据自己的需求选择适合的SSL证书类型,如单域名证书、多域名证书、通配符证书等。不同类型的证书
2023-04-06
ssl证书申请时需要提交的资料
SSL证书是一种数字证书,用于通过公开密钥加密技术保护互联网上的数据传输。SSL证书的作用是确保网站的安全性和可靠性,以保护用户的个人信息和敏感数据。在申请SSL证书时,需要提供以下资料:1. 域名信息SSL证书是与域名绑定的,因此在申请SSL证书时,需要
2023-04-06
steam怎么申请ssl
SSL(Secure Sockets Layer)是一种加密通信协议,可以在互联网上保护数据的安全传输。Steam作为一个在线游戏平台,也需要使用SSL来保护用户数据的安全传输。在这篇文章中,我将介绍Steam如何申请SSL证书的原理和详细过程。SSL证书
2023-04-06
如何申请商用ssl证书
SSL证书是一种用于保护网站和网络应用程序的安全协议。商用SSL证书是一种数字证书,可以帮助网站实现加密通信、身份验证和数据完整性保护,从而提高客户的信任度和安全性。本文将介绍商用SSL证书的申请原理和详细步骤。一、商用SSL证书的原理商用SSL证书是通过
2023-04-06
在哪里申请ssl证书比较好
SSL证书是一种用于加密通信的数字证书,常用于保护网站的敏感信息,如用户登录、支付等操作。如果您的网站需要收集用户敏感信息,那么使用SSL证书就非常必要。在本文中,我们将介绍您可以在哪里申请SSL证书以及如何选择最适合您的证书。1. 什么是SSL证书?SS
2023-04-06
ssl证书购买与申请
SSL证书是一种用于加密网络通信的安全协议,常用于网站、电子邮件和即时通讯等应用。SSL证书的作用是为了保护用户的隐私和安全,防止黑客攻击和信息泄露。本文将详细介绍SSL证书的购买和申请流程。一、SSL证书的原理SSL证书通过数字签名的方式来保证通信双方的
2023-04-06
ssl申请认证失败常见原因
SSL(Secure Sockets Layer)是一种安全套接字层协议,主要用于保护网络通信的安全性。SSL证书是一种数字证书,用于证明网站的身份和数据的加密性,是保障网站安全的重要组成部分。然而,SSL申请认证失败是一个常见的问题,下面将介绍一些常见的
2023-04-06
创建证书申请 ssl
SSL(Secure Sockets Layer)是一种用于保证网络安全的协议,它通过创建一个安全通道来加密数据传输,以防止黑客攻击、窃取数据等不良行为。在使用 SSL 时,需要向证书颁发机构(CA)申请 SSL 证书,以验证网站身份并为其加密通信。下面是
2023-04-06